单词 unpolar
释义

unpolaradj.

Brit. /(ˌ)ʌnˈpəʊlə/, U.S. /ˌənˈpoʊlər/
Origin: Formed within English, by derivation. Etymons: un- prefix1, polar adj.
Etymology: < un- prefix1 + polar adj.
Science.
Not polar (in various senses); = non-polar adj.

1843 E. M. Clarke List Prices Instruments 73 Suspend a similar bar of unpolar or soft iron.
1899 Jrnl. Physiol. 23 Suppl. p. xiv The electrical conductivity of chloroformed as compared with normal nerve (+ the unpolar electrodes) was found to be raised.
1960 Proc. Royal Soc. A 258 377 Unpolar crystals, such as diamond, silicon or germanium, should show no infra-red absorption.
1980 C. Liljenberg in P. Mazliac et al. Biogenesis & Function Plant Lipids 32 The most unpolar solvent (light petrol) extracted all the β-carotene.
2007 New Phytologist 176 315/2 A gradient occurs between outer unpolar and inner less unpolar wax.
